Cooling Chronicles A Journey Through The Evolution Of Air Conditioning 1902: willis carrier creates the first modern electrical air conditioning unit, originally designed to control humidity in a printing plant rather than for human comfort. 1914: the first home air conditioner is installed in a minneapolis mansion. this early unit was enormous – approximately 2.1 metres high, 1.8 metres wide, and 6 metres long!. Architectural features such as wind towers and qanats were designed to capture and channel natural airflow, providing natural ventilation and cooling to homes and buildings. these early examples of passive cooling demonstrate the ingenuity of ancient societies in harnessing natural elements to enhance indoor comfort. In the middle ages, persian engineers developed wind towers that captured cool breezes and directed them into buildings. these early methods laid the groundwork for modern air conditioning technology. the modern era of air conditioning began in the early 20th century. in 1902, willis carrier invented the first mechanical air conditioning system. Following carrier’s invention, air conditioning technology rapidly advanced. the 1920s saw the introduction of residential air conditioning units, making home cooling accessible to more people. by the 1950s, air conditioning became a standard feature in homes and businesses, transforming the way we live and work. The demand for cooling in homes grew steadily over the years, but only after the end of world war ii did air conditioning units become more common, smaller, easier to install, and more affordable. these changes led to a significant shift in living standards and population migration to warmer regions. Smart cooling: iot integration and automation. the incorporation of internet of things (iot) technology has revolutionized traditional air conditioning, turning it into intelligent and effective systems. intelligent thermostats, sensors, and automated controls empower users to remotely oversee and regulate their cooling systems.
